AMATO v. NEW YORK CITY DEPT. OF PARKS & RECREATION

10659, 100437/12.

110 A.D.3d 439 (2013)

973 N.Y.S.2d 29

2013 NY Slip Op 6425

PETER AMATO et al., Appellants, v. NEW YORK CITY DEPARTMENT OF PARKS AND RECREATION et al., Respondents, et al., Defendants.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, First Department.

Decided October 3, 2013.


Order, Supreme Court, New York County (Geoffrey D. Wright, J.), entered July 9, 2012, which granted defendants' motion to dismiss the complaint, unanimously affirmed, without costs.
